Output 81fc8fab8880e16f49541116c074e06f23eab4e117a346f514b0f4d18bf8401b:1

value
6972647532234
script pubkey
OP_0 OP_PUSHBYTES_20 d8bb06680ffbb684cf67f9401c74666da5d8ac14
address
tb1qmzasv6q0lwmgfnm8l9qpcarxdkja3tq5xu5za4
transaction
81fc8fab8880e16f49541116c074e06f23eab4e117a346f514b0f4d18bf8401b
confirmations
186567
spent
true